Trip Overview

This 58.3-mile drive from Turnersville to Brick, New Jersey, can be completed in about 1 hour and 31 minutes, making it a perfect day trip. The route is primarily highway-focused, with 72% of the journey on higher-speed roads. Expect a fuel cost of around $10 for this trip. Since it's a relatively short drive, you'll have plenty of flexibility for spontaneous stops along the way. This journey stays within the Northeast region, offering a straightforward commute through the Garden State.

Drive Character

This is largely a highway-focused drive, with 72% of the mileage on faster roads. You'll spend a significant portion of your time on NJ 70, including a 29.9-mile stretch without needing to divert. Expect a consistent pace as you navigate through Lakehurst Circle and continue on NJ 70 East. The character of the road remains fairly uniform for most of the trip, maintaining a steady rhythm suitable for covering ground efficiently.

Most of the miles stay on highways, which makes pacing and fuel planning easier than turn-by-turn city driving.
There are about 24 navigation steps in the underlying route data, so the final approach matters more than the middle miles.
NJ 70 is the longest continuous segment at about 29.9 miles.

How Hard Is This Drive?

This is a straightforward highway drive that stays mostly on NJ 70 and NJ 70 East. You will hit about 16 points where you need to pay attention to lane position or signs. The trickiest moment comes around 1.3 miles in near CR 673 / College Drive.

Driving Effort 6/10

Moderate - straightforward overall, but long enough or busy enough to require pacing

Balances navigation complexity with total wheel time.

This drive requires moderate attention. Across 58.3 miles you will encounter 16 spots where lane choice or exit timing matters. Not difficult for experienced highway drivers, but worth previewing the tricky sections before you go.

Where does it get tricky?

The main spots that need attention: at 1.3 miles (CR 673 / College Drive): Roundabout - know your exit number before entering; at 12 miles (NJ 70): Lane positioning matters here; at 21.9 miles (NJ 70): Roundabout - know your exit number before entering. Multiple destination signs - pick the right one.
